BeWoman Asia forum held in Almaty

Almaty hosted the BeWoman Asia Forum – the largest women’s leadership platform in Central Asia, El.kz reports.

The event was held with the support of the National Commission on Women and Family-Demographic Policy under the President of Kazakhstan and the Ministry of Culture and Information.

The forum brought together over a hundred participants from twenty countries.

Kazakh Minister of Culture and Sport Aida Balayeva emphasized that the portrait of the modern Kazakh woman reflects the work, knowledge, and leadership of millions of women shaping the country’s future.

“We must promote and instill in the younger generation the values of the concepts ‘Law and Order,’ ‘Taza Kazakhstan,’ and ‘Adal Azamat’: inner culture and respect for the law, responsibility and diligence, respect for traditions and nature, as well as unity and tolerance,” the minister said.

According to her, Kazakhstan is ahead of a number of countries in protecting women’s rights, yet issues of gender equality and the development of women’s entrepreneurship remain relevant.

“Today we have progressive laws in the field of family and domestic relations. Harassment has been recognized as a criminal offense, strict liability has been introduced for domestic violence, and bride kidnapping is now equated with serious crimes punishable by up to ten years in prison,” Balayeva stressed.

This year, the central theme of the forum, held under the motto “Transformation. Personality. Family. Society. Future. Leadership. Inspiration. Unity,” focused on digitalization, artificial intelligence, business, and the value of the family institution. The speakers included well-known entrepreneurs, researchers, journalists, and influencers.
